About the College

RMIT’s College of Business and Law takes an industry and student-centered approach to its courses and programs, ensuring graduates are work ready and able to tackle business challenges, balance stakeholder needs, act as socially responsible global citizens and create fair and positive futures for all.  The College delivers impactful research informed by industry, which supports its strong position as a College at the intersection of business and technology with social impact. Its important work is underpinned by the principles of quality, collaboration, big ideas and putting people first. As one of the largest Business Schools in the Asia Pacific region, the College is comprised of five schools – four in Melbourne and one in Vietnam – and delivers a broad range of programs in Business and Law, ranging from Degree to PhD levels. The College’s Business and Law programs are delivered in Melbourne as well as through RMIT Online, with its Business programs also available in Vietnam and through partner institutions in Singapore and Shanghai. The College employs over 1000 staff and delivers programs to over 26,000 students. The College’s central operations are located at RMIT University’s City Campus in Melbourne and reside in the Swanston Academic and Emily McPherson buildings.
